SEOUL, Jan. 30 (Yonhap) - Actor Park Bo-gum has signed a contract with The Black Label, a management company founded by singer TEDDY.

 

"We have signed a management contract with Park Bo-gum," The Black Label said on Monday. "As Park Bo-gum has various charms and talents, we will fully support him to deepen his charm as an actor in various fields."

 

Park Bo-gum, who debuted in 2012 with the movie Blind, rose to stardom with the drama "Reply 1988," and starred in the dramas "Love in the Moonlight," "Encounter," "Record of Youth," "Roaring Currents," "Coin Locker Girl," "Seobok" and "Wonderland."

 

The Black Label, an affiliate of YG Entertainment, is a hip-hop label founded by TEDDY in 2016, and includes singers Zion.T and Jeon So-mi, and group Big Bang's Taeyang.
